473mL can, pours a cloudy opaque bright yellow with a small white head. Aroma brings out fresh farmhouse yeast, with bright citrus, floral hops, and biscuity malt. Flavour is along the same lines, with fresh farmhouse yeast, citrus hops, doughy malt, and biscuity malt. Bright and clean. Very good.

Has great creamy white foam and a semi-cloudy yellow body with just the right amount of carbonation. Smells of very nice yeast and lemon note, has soft bright grain hints. Flavour is mellow soft fruit juice and yeast. Mouthfeel is full with just the right amount of wetness. This is very nice, very refreshing.

Draught at the brewery
Pale blond colour, murky. Gentle citrus aroma, gentle spicy yeast. Dry mouthfeel, quite weak, with delicate spicy yeast, and very light citrus hopping; unbfortunately the finish is too short and weak; the low bitterness won't allow to elect this as thirst quencher either.
Little beer indeed, it has a couple of good arguments, but could develop more.
